2362453231 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 2362453232. Its totient is φ = 2362453230.

The previous prime is 2362453213. The next prime is 2362453307. The reversal of 2362453231 is 1323542632.

2362453231 is digitally balanced in base 2, because in such base it contains all the possibile digits an equal number of times.

Together with previous prime (2362453213) it forms an Ormiston pair, because they use the same digits, order apart.

It is a weak pr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 2362453231 - 213 = 2362445039 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×23624532312 = 11162370537324678722, which contains 22 as substring.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 2362453193 and 2362453202.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(2362453631)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 1181226615 + 1181226616.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(1181226616).

Almost surely, 22362453231 is an apocalyptic number.

2362453231 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

2362453231 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

2362453231 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its digits is 25920, while the sum is 31.

The square root of 2362453231 is about 48605.0741281196. The cubic root of 2362453231 is about 1331.8472139036.

Adding to 2362453231 its reverse (1323542632), we get a palindrome (3685995863).
